FAQs about Invisalign

What do Invisalign aligners look like?

Invisalign aligners look nothing like conventional metal braces. There are no archwires, brackets or rubber bands--only pairs of crystal clear appliances which snap over the top and bottom teeth. Customized to move your teeth, the thin aligners are removable, smooth and unnoticeable.

How can such a thin appliance move your teeth?

Aligners are made from patented SmartTrack acrylic according to special three-dimensional scans taken at Central Jersey Dental Arts in Piscataway. With these images and your dentist's instructions, the Invisalign lab technician crafts your aligner pairs--18 to 30 pairs in all, which you'll wear according to a specific sequence. The aligners exert measured forces on your teeth, and when worn 20 to 22 hours a day, your treatment plan stays on track.

What kinds of problems does Invisalign correct?

Except for very complex smile alignment issues, Invisalign can correct many kinds of orthodontic issues such as:

  • Improper dental bite (overbite and underbite, as examples)
    • Protruding front teeth
    • Crowding
    • Gaps
    • Tooth rotation and tipping

Both teens and adults can qualify for treatment. Teen aligners may be equipped with special tabs to accommodate teeth not fully erupted.

Is treatment difficult?

No, it's not. Aligners are easy to care for, and you won't have to restrict what you eat. You may experience some soreness as you start your treatment plan, but overall, your mouth will feel good. Also, you can remove your appliances to eat, brush, and floss. Most Invisalign treatment plans finish up in about a year.

What happens when I finish my care plan?

You will have a beautiful, straight, functional and healthy smile. Your dentist may recommend you wear a retaining device (likely your last aligner pair) for a period of time to stabilize your teeth.
